Engeron approves bond
quote:The point of this exercise was to ensure that the surety had the liquidity to satisfy its obligations under the bond. These new conditions appear to provide that.
While Engoron allowed the bond to stand, Trump and Knight Specialty Insurance Company agreed to meet several new requirements, per a spokesperson from the New York State Attorney General's office.
These include that Knight Specialty Insurance Company will retain "exclusive control" of the $175 million account, and the company and Trump will provide a monthly account statement certifying that there are sufficient cash funds for the bond.
Knight Specialty Insurance Company has agreed to designate an agent of process in New York.
The agreement between the company and Trump also can't be amended without court approval.

Trump may have $175m in cash, but why tie up his money while this gets appealed. That could take years.
The bond is essentially an insurance policy. The purchase of which is paid via a premium. In this case the surety company charges a rate based on the side of the bond.
If I had to guess the sure company charged 3% of the bond amount ($175m). Thus, the bond cost Trump around $5,250,000.
The carrier keeps the premium for posting the bond.
So in essence the surety company just made $5,250,000 in profit off of trump.
He’s not defaulting on the bond and he pledged significant cash assets to make the surety would be made whole should he default and they have to pay the $175m.
It was a no brainer from the surety pout of view.
0% chance of risk and they make $5m
